Nedavno Apache Software Foundation najavila je novu verziju integriranog razvojnog okruženja Apache NetBeans 11.0. Ova nova verzija dolazi s nekoliko promjena jer je eksperimentalna podrška dodana nekim novim izrazima.
Apache NetBeans 11.0 postaje treća verzija koju je pripremila Apache Foundation nakon prijenosa NetBeans koda u Oracle.
Verzija sadrži podršku za programske jezike Java SE, Java EE, PHP, JavaScript i Groovy. Prijenos podrške za C / C ++ iz baze koda koju je prenio Oracle očekuje se u jednoj od sljedećih verzija.
O NetBeansu
NetBeans je besplatno integrirano razvojno okruženje, stvoreno prvenstveno za programski jezik Java. Postoji i značajan broj modula za njegovo proširenje. NetBeans IDE je besplatan i besplatan proizvod bez ograničenja upotrebe.
NetBeans je vrlo uspješan projekt otvorenog koda s velikom bazom korisnika, zajednica koja stalno raste.
Trenutno je projekat još uvijek u razvoju Apache-a, koja priprema infrastrukturu, revidira čistoću licence i testira sposobnost pridržavanja razvojnih principa usvojenih u zajednici Apača.
U budućnosti, čim se projekat pokaže spremnim za samostalno postojanje koje ne zahtijeva dodatni nadzor.
Platforma nudi uobičajene usluge za višekratnu upotrebu za desktop aplikacije, omogućavajući programerima da se usredotoče na logiku svojih aplikacija.
Neke od glavnih karakteristika NetBeans-a su:
- Upravljanje korisničkim sučeljem (izbornici i alatne trake).
- Upravljanje korisničkom konfiguracijom.
- Upravljanje pohranom (spremite ili učitajte neku vrstu podataka).
- Upravljanje prozorima.
- Čarobnjak (podržava korak-po-korak dijaloge).
- Vizualna biblioteka Netbeans.
- Integrirani razvojni alati.
NetBeans IDE je besplatna, otvorena platforma sa više platformi sa ugrađenom podrškom za programski jezik Java.
Ključne nove značajke Apache NetBeans 11.0
Dolaskom ove nove verzije Apache NetBeans 11.0 i uz pomoć različitih diskusija koju je vodila zajednica tokom protekle godine, U ovoj novoj verziji donesena je odluka o promjeni dizajna čarobnjaka za stvaranje novog projekta.
Que Pored podrške Apache Antu, s obzirom na mogućnost, dodane su dvije nove opcije: "Java s Maven" i "Java s Gradle".
S druge strane takođe Može se primijetiti da je podrška za JDK 12 već dodana u ovoj verziji, kao i uključivanje nove verzije kompajlera nb-javac sa podrškom za Javu 12.
Isticanje sintakse, automatsko dovršavanje, savjeti i poravnanje izraza "promjena" su značajno prošireni.
S druge strane, kao što smo spomenuli na početku si dodana eksperimentalna podrška za novi oblik izraza od »prekidača« koji se pojavio u Javi 12 (uključen u režim «–enable-preview») i mogućnost pretvaranja starog obrasca u novi.
Izmijenjene su licence za Java Enterprise komponente i vraćena je podrška za JavaEE.
Slično tome, implementirana je sposobnost stvaranja JavaEE aplikacija pomoću Ant, Maven ili Gradle. Zbog nekompatibilnosti s licencom Apache, ukinuti su JBoss 4, WebLogic 9 i modul websvc.switmodellext.
U toj je verziji dodata podrška za graditeljski sistem Gradle i predložena su sučelja za kretanje kroz skripte i zadatke sklopa Gradle, pružena je mogućnost kreiranja Gradle projekata, dodana je podrška za korištenje Gradlea s jedinicama test okvira (JUnit 4/5, TestNG ), implementirana je podrška za NetBeans JPA i Spring.
Kako instalirati NetBeans 11.0 na Linux?
Za one koji žele nabaviti ovu novu verziju NetBeans 11.0 Na svom sistemu moraju imati instaliranu barem verziju Java 8 Oracle ili Open JDK v8 i Apache Ant 1.10 ili noviju.
Sada moraju preuzeti izvorni kod aplikacije koju mogu dobiti sa linka ispod.
Nakon što sve instalirate, raspakirajte novo preuzetu datoteku u direktorij po vašem ukusu.
A s terminala ćemo ući u ovaj direktorij, a zatim izvršiti:
ant
Za izgradnju Apache NetBeans IDE-a. Jednom izgrađen, možete pokrenuti IDE upisivanjem
./nbbuild/netbeans/bin/netbeans
Hvala na vijestima.
Za nas koji volimo stvari lagane, sada je dostupan kao Snap
sudo snap instaliraj netbeans –classic
Hvala na ovom drugom načinu instalacije :).
Dobro jutro.